Introduction
The rapid growth of e-commerce has transformed how businesses sell, scale, and compete in the digital marketplace. From handling thousands of daily transactions to managing product catalogs, customer data, inventory systems, and analytics, modern e-commerce platforms rely heavily on databases. As traffic and operational complexity increase, database performance and cost management become critical to sustaining growth.
Two key strategies that help organizations maintain efficiency and scalability are database optimization and cost attribution. Together, these approaches enable e-commerce businesses to improve application performance, reduce infrastructure costs, and gain visibility into how resources are consumed across their platforms.
This article explores how database optimization and cost attribution can significantly improve e-commerce performance and how organizations can implement these strategies effectively.
Understanding the Role of Databases in E-commerce
Every action on an e-commerce platform interacts with databases. Whether customers browse products, add items to carts, complete purchases, or track orders, database queries power these processes.
Key database functions in e-commerce include:
- Product catalog management
- Inventory tracking
- Customer data storage
- Order processing
- Payment transactions
- Personalization and recommendations
- Analytics and reporting
If the database becomes slow or inefficient, the entire e-commerce experience suffers. Pages take longer to load, checkout becomes slower, and customers may abandon their carts.
Studies consistently show that even a one-second delay in page load time can significantly reduce conversions. Therefore, maintaining high database performance is essential for both customer satisfaction and revenue growth.
Illustration of two people analyzing online shopping data on a large laptop screen, surrounded by charts, graphs, coins, and ecommerce icons.

What is Database Optimization?
Database optimization refers to the process of improving database performance, efficiency, and scalability by refining queries, structures, and resource usage.
In e-commerce environments, optimization helps ensure that databases can handle high traffic, complex queries, and large volumes of data without slowing down.
Key Areas of Database Optimization
1. Query Optimization
Poorly written queries are one of the most common causes of slow database performance.
Optimizing queries involves:
- Eliminating unnecessary joins
- Using efficient indexing
- Avoiding redundant data retrieval
- Improving filtering logic
- Reducing large data scans
Optimized queries allow systems to retrieve data faster and reduce server workload.
2. Index Management
Indexes help databases locate data quickly without scanning entire tables.
However, improper indexing can create performance bottlenecks. Businesses should:
- Add indexes for frequently queried columns
- Remove unused indexes
- Monitor index fragmentation
- Use composite indexes for complex queries
Proper indexing can dramatically improve product search performance and customer data retrieval.
3. Database Architecture Optimization
E-commerce systems often require scalable database architectures that support large volumes of transactions.
Common architectural strategies include:
- Database sharding
- Read replicas
- Data partitioning
- Distributed databases
- Caching layers
These techniques help platforms handle spikes in traffic during sales events or peak shopping seasons.
4. Resource Utilization Monitoring
Database servers consume compute resources such as CPU, memory, and storage.
Monitoring resource utilization helps organizations identify inefficiencies and ensure optimal use of infrastructure.
Key metrics include:
- Query execution time
- CPU usage
- Memory consumption
- Disk I/O
- Active sessions
Advanced monitoring tools can automatically detect performance anomalies and recommend improvements.
What is Cost Attribution?
Cost attribution is the process of assigning infrastructure and operational costs to specific workloads, teams, applications, or business functions.
In e-commerce environments, databases often consume a significant portion of IT budgets. Without clear visibility, organizations may struggle to understand where resources are being used.
Cost attribution helps businesses answer critical questions such as:
- Which services generate the highest database costs?
- Which queries consume the most resources?
- Which teams are responsible for specific database workloads?
- Which applications require scaling?
By identifying these cost drivers, organizations can optimize spending and allocate resources more effectively.
Benefits of Database Optimization for E-commerce
1. Faster Website Performance
Optimized databases significantly reduce response times. Faster product searches, checkout processes, and page loads create a smoother shopping experience.
Improved performance leads to:
- Higher customer satisfaction
- Increased conversions
- Lower cart abandonment rates
2. Improved Scalability
As e-commerce businesses grow, databases must handle larger datasets and higher traffic volumes.
Database optimization ensures systems can scale efficiently without major infrastructure upgrades.
3. Reduced Operational Costs
Inefficient queries and poorly optimized databases consume excessive computing resources.
Optimization reduces resource usage and helps organizations control infrastructure costs.
4. Better Customer Experience
Customers expect seamless online shopping experiences. Faster database operations improve:
- Product search speed
- Personalized recommendations
- Order tracking
- Checkout performance
These improvements directly impact customer retention and brand loyalty.
How Cost Attribution Improves E-commerce Operations
1. Increased Financial Transparency
Cost attribution allows businesses to clearly understand how database resources are used across departments and services.
This transparency helps IT and finance teams collaborate more effectively.
2. Smarter Budget Allocation
With accurate cost insights, organizations can allocate budgets to the most critical applications and services.
High-impact workloads can receive priority investment while inefficient systems are optimized.
3. Identifying Inefficient Workloads
Cost attribution highlights workloads that consume excessive resources.
Examples include:
- Inefficient queries
- Over-provisioned infrastructure
- Unused database instances
- Redundant processes
By addressing these issues, businesses can significantly reduce IT costs.
4. Improved Accountability
Cost attribution encourages teams to manage resources responsibly.
When departments understand their infrastructure costs, they are more likely to optimize applications and database usage.
Implementing Database Optimization and Cost Attribution
To successfully implement these strategies, organizations should follow a structured approach.
Step 1: Assess Current Database Performance
Start by evaluating the current state of your database environment.
Analyze metrics such as:
- Query performance
- Resource utilization
- Storage growth
- Infrastructure costs
This baseline assessment helps identify optimization opportunities.
Step 2: Implement Monitoring and Analytics Tools
Advanced monitoring platforms provide real-time insights into database performance and costs.
These tools help identify slow queries, inefficient workloads, and unusual resource consumption patterns.
Step 3: Optimize Database Queries and Structures
Database administrators and developers should collaborate to improve query design and database structures.
Regular optimization activities should include:
- Query tuning
- Index optimization
- Data partitioning
- Schema improvements
Step 4: Establish Cost Attribution Models
Define how database costs will be attributed across teams and applications.
Common attribution methods include:
- Application-based attribution
- Department-based attribution
- Workload-based attribution
- User-based attribution
These models provide clear visibility into resource usage.
Step 5: Continuously Monitor and Improve
Database optimization is not a one-time task. Continuous monitoring ensures performance remains stable as workloads evolve.
Regular audits and performance reviews help maintain optimal efficiency.
The Future of E-commerce Database Management
As e-commerce platforms become more sophisticated, database management will continue to evolve.
Emerging trends include:
- AI-driven database optimization
- Autonomous databases
- Real-time cost analytics
- Serverless database architectures
- Intelligent workload automation
These innovations will help organizations manage growing data volumes while maintaining high performance and cost efficiency.
Conclusion
In the competitive world of e-commerce, database performance and cost management play a critical role in business success. Slow queries, inefficient resource usage, and unclear infrastructure costs can significantly impact both customer experience and profitability.
By implementing database optimization and cost attribution strategies, e-commerce businesses can achieve faster platform performance, improved scalability, and better financial control.
Organizations that invest in these technologies gain deeper insights into their database environments, enabling them to make smarter operational decisions and support long-term growth.
Ultimately, optimizing database performance while maintaining cost efficiency empowers e-commerce companies to deliver seamless shopping experiences and stay competitive in the rapidly evolving digital marketplace.
Frequently Asked Questions (FAQs)
1. What is database optimization in e-commerce?
Database optimization involves improving database performance by refining queries, indexing structures, and resource utilization. It ensures faster data retrieval and smoother platform performance.
2. Why is database performance important for e-commerce platforms?
Database performance directly impacts website speed, checkout processes, and customer experience. Slow databases can lead to cart abandonment and lost revenue.
3. What is cost attribution in database management?
Cost attribution assigns infrastructure and operational costs to specific applications, teams, or workloads. It helps organizations understand how resources are consumed and optimize spending.
4. How can database optimization reduce infrastructure costs?
Optimized databases require fewer computing resources. Efficient queries and indexing reduce CPU, memory, and storage usage, lowering overall infrastructure expenses.
5. What tools are commonly used for database performance monitoring?
Common database monitoring tools include performance management platforms, cloud monitoring solutions, and analytics dashboards that track query performance, resource utilization, and system health.
6. How often should databases be optimized?
Database optimization should be an ongoing process. Regular monitoring and periodic performance reviews ensure systems remain efficient as workloads grow.
7. Can cost attribution improve collaboration between IT and finance teams?
Yes. Cost attribution provides transparency into infrastructure spending, allowing IT and finance teams to make informed budgeting and resource allocation decisions.
The views expressed on this blog are those of the author and do not necessarily reflect the opinions of Enteros Inc. This blog may contain links to the content of third-party sites. By providing such links, Enteros Inc. does not adopt, guarantee, approve, or endorse the information, views, or products available on such sites.
Are you interested in writing for Enteros’ Blog? Please send us a pitch!
RELATED POSTS
How to Optimize Healthcare Sector Growth with Enteros Management Platform, Cost Estimation, Cost Attribution, and Database Software
- 19 April 2026
- Database Performance Management
Introduction The healthcare sector is undergoing a rapid digital transformation driven by electronic health records (EHRs), telemedicine, data analytics, and AI-powered diagnostics. Hospitals, clinics, and healthcare providers are increasingly relying on advanced IT systems to improve patient outcomes, streamline operations, and manage costs. However, this transformation introduces a critical challenge:how to scale healthcare services efficiently … Continue reading “How to Optimize Healthcare Sector Growth with Enteros Management Platform, Cost Estimation, Cost Attribution, and Database Software”
How to Optimize Retail Sector Growth with Enteros Database Management Platform, AIOps, and Cloud FinOps
Introduction The retail sector is experiencing rapid transformation fueled by digital innovation, evolving customer expectations, and the rise of omnichannel commerce. From eCommerce platforms and mobile apps to in-store analytics and supply chain systems, retailers rely heavily on technology to deliver seamless and personalized shopping experiences. However, this digital expansion brings a fundamental challenge:how to … Continue reading “How to Optimize Retail Sector Growth with Enteros Database Management Platform, AIOps, and Cloud FinOps”
Why BFSI Leaders Are Turning to Enteros for Database Optimization, AI Ops, and Cloud FinOps Excellence
- 16 April 2026
- Database Performance Management
Introduction The Banking, Financial Services, and Insurance (BFSI) sector is undergoing a massive digital transformation. With the rise of digital banking, real-time payments, fraud detection systems, and AI-driven financial services, organizations are becoming increasingly dependent on high-performance data infrastructure. From managing millions of transactions per second to enabling real-time risk analysis and personalized customer experiences, … Continue reading “Why BFSI Leaders Are Turning to Enteros for Database Optimization, AI Ops, and Cloud FinOps Excellence”
How to Optimize Telecom Sector Growth with Enteros AIOps Platform, Resource Metadata, Hierarchy Metadata, Spot Instances, and RevOps Efficiency
Introduction The telecom sector is at the center of global digital transformation, enabling connectivity for billions of users, businesses, and emerging technologies like IoT, 5G, and edge computing. As demand for high-speed, reliable communication services continues to rise, telecom providers are under immense pressure to scale operations efficiently while maintaining performance and controlling costs. However, … Continue reading “How to Optimize Telecom Sector Growth with Enteros AIOps Platform, Resource Metadata, Hierarchy Metadata, Spot Instances, and RevOps Efficiency”